Rates are $40something for a half-hour and I believe $70something for an hour. Definitely aim to get there a half-hour early and hang out, because I once arrived at 4:54 hoping for the 5PM and they had already closed up shop.
Also, MINI GOLF WAS FUN! I think it was 18 holes mostly par 1-3, and about 5 of these contained little models of historic buildings, such as the Windlass's original tavern from the 19th century(?), a local 1925 roller coaster, and the Lake Hopatcong dam. They had little plaques about the history of each structure, with 2 historic photographs and a paragraph's writeup about it. It was great and educational, a fun way to get acquainted with Lake Hopatcong history in a sunny setting. The lake was very calm and peaceful during our 10am tour, which made for a great ride. It may seem very intimidating at first to get on the bike, however the staff are very attentive and helpful. Once you are on, it’s fairly easy to maneuver the bike. Just a warning, you will get a good workout in with this tour (especially the 1 hour tour) but it really is very fun!!
I suggest wearing water shoes since there’s a chance your feet may get wet. It can be breezy in the morning, so bring a jacket and wear SPF! The bikes have water bottle holders and a compartment to fit a small bag. Life vests are also provided.
